Introduction

A hydraulic stacker lift is an essential piece of equipment in material handling, designed to lift and transport loads efficiently. Used widely in warehouses and manufacturing plants, understanding their mechanics can aid in maximizing utility and safety.

Working Principle of Hydraulic Stacker Lifts

The working mechanism of a hydraulic stacker lift is based on the principles of hydraulics, utilizing fluid power to generate motion and force. The key process involves:

  1. Power Source Activation: Electric or manual pumping initiates the flow of hydraulic fluid.
  2. Hydraulic Pressure Generation: The pump increases the pressure of the hydraulic fluid, transferring energy.
  3. Cylinder Operation: Pressurized fluid moves into the hydraulic cylinder, extending the piston and lifting the load.
  4. Load Adjustment: Reversing the valve allows fluid to return to the reservoir, lowering the load.

Key Components

  1. Hydraulic Pump: Converts mechanical power into hydraulic energy.
  2. Hydraulic Cylinder: The actuator that carries the load by piston movement.
  3. Reservoir: Stores hydraulic fluid and dissipates heat.
  4. Control Valves: Manage the flow and direction of the fluid.
  5. Lifting Platform: Supports the load during lifting operations.

Performance Analysis

Hydraulic stacker lifts are evaluated based on several parameters:

  • Load Capacity: Typically ranges from 500 to 3000 kg, defining the maximum load a stacker can handle efficiently.
  • Lifting Height: Varies from 1.5m to 5m, depending on model specifications and operational needs.
  • Hydraulic Fluid Pressure: Generally between 160 to 200 bar, critical for achieving necessary lifting force.
  • Speed: Lift and descent rates averaged at 0.05 m/s and 0.04 m/s respectively for operator safety.
